Q1 2026 overview

What this importer's trade footprint looks like

Gulf Marine de Mexico processed 73 shipments in Q1 2026 across 34 HS codes, sourcing entirely from the United States. The importer relied on two suppliers, both operating under the Mercury Marine brand, with 72 of 73 shipments originating from Mercury Marine. Machinery and engines (HS Chapter 84) dominated the import profile, with HS code 840991 accounting for approximately 18% of total shipment volume.

Methodology. Snapshot built from US Customs AMS import and export bill-of-lading records arrived between Q1 2026 (Jan – Mar). Supplier risk score is a composite of activity, diversification, stability, recency, forwarder-cleanness, HS consistency, sanctions screen, and forced-labor proximity. Sanctions screen runs trigram similarity against the OpenSanctions FTM corpus (4.2M+ records, 32,982 sanctioned entities, 91,894 names + aliases). Forced-labor proximity is a haversine distance from each CN supplier's resolved coordinate to the nearest of 380 documented facilities in the ASPI Xinjiang Data Project.
